Mid-Columbia Traditional Arts & Music Association Presents The Winter Show | Richland WAThe Mid-Columbia Traditional Arts & Music Association will present The Winter Show on January 7, 2017. This event will run from 1:00 p.m. until 4:30 p.m. and will be held at the Richland Community Center, at 500 Amon Park Rd N, Richland WA. For more details, please visit the Winter Show page at the MCTAMA's website.

About The MCTAMA Winter Show
The MCTAMA Winter Show is a free event that will feature an open mic opportunity for individuals who want to showcase their singing talent. Interested performers should sign up at 1:00 p.m. Performers are advised to use only acoustic music for the show but amplified bases will also be considered. MCTAMA Winter Show attendees are encouraged to bring and share some finger snacks. Don't miss it!
